CONSERVATION OFFICERS UNCOVER A CRIME EVEN DARKER THAN POACHING. Two fly-in poachers go on a caribou killing spree in Polar Bear Provincial Park. Annie Wabano, a resourceful young Cree teen, goes missing in Peawanuck. When the COs initiate a poaching investigation, shots are fired. The officers are left adrift on James Bay, and their women stranded in the bush. So begins a case of wilderness survival for both halves of the group. Police and Natural Resources personnel pull out all the stops to track down the dangerous poachers. The case escalates into a murder investigation, which is unexpectedly linked to the teen's disappearance. And only Annie can lead the authorities to the criminals' hangout.
